CVE-2021-41783
HIGHCVSS 7.8/10EPSS 1.25%
Last modified
CVE-2021-41783 is a high-severity vulnerability rated 7.8/10 on the CVSS scale. Foxit PDF Reader before 11.1 and PDF Editor before 11.1, and PhantomPDF before 10.1.6, allow attackers to trigger a use-after-free and execute arbitrary code because JavaScript is mishandled.. EPSS estimates a 1.25%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.

Affected Software
| Vendor | Product | Versions |
|---|---|---|
| Foxit | Pdf Editor | >= 11.0, < 11.1 |
| Foxit | Pdf Reader | >= 11.0, < 11.1 |
| Foxit | Phantompdf | < 10.1.6 |
